Every dripping faucet tells a story of gradual component failure that nearly every homeowner faces eventually. The primary causes include worn washers that become hardened after extensive use, allowing water to escape despite the handle being fully turned off. O-ring seals deteriorate gradually from repeated pressure and temperature shifts, creating small gaps where drips escape. In single-handle designs, faulty cartridges become problematic when internal seals wear out or when sediment interferes with smooth operation.
Hard water mineral buildup exacerbates problems with deposits that create uneven surfaces and imperfect closure. Elevated water pressure in homes, often higher than ideal, adds extra stress to every part, speeding up wear. Temperature fluctuations also contribute causing materials to expand and contract repeatedly until they no longer maintain a tight seal. The cumulative effect produces that familiar drip sound that reverberates around the plumbing.
According to reliable water conservation authorities, a faucet dripping once per second wastes over three thousand gallons annually—enough to fill a large bathtub multiple times over. Slower drips still add hundreds of gallons monthly. That dripping creates persistent anxiety, serving as a regular reminder of wasted water in stillness. Each faucet category fails in expected patterns according to its design. Classic compression faucets depend on rubber washers against metal valve seats. As the washer becomes compressed or splits, water seeps past. Newer cartridge faucets regulate flow with internal parts that become compromised by sediment accumulation or seal degradation. Ceramic disc faucets offer greater durability but still succumb when seals degrade or debris interferes with disc alignment. Accurate faucet type recognition makes repair much easier.
San Diego water quality presents distinct challenges. San Diego's hard water quickly builds calcium and magnesium deposits. Such deposits roughen surfaces and block tight seals. Elevated water pressure in many municipal systems adds mechanical stress to stems, packing nuts, and internal parts. Homes built decades ago often retain original fixtures that have endured years of use under these conditions, increasing likelihood of multiple simultaneous failures.
Local conditions account for more frequent dripping faucets versus locations with lower mineral content. Good DIY leaky faucet repair requires careful preparation. Gather necessary tools including adjustable pliers, various screwdrivers, Allen wrenches, replacement washers, O-rings, cartridges, plumber's grease, and Teflon tape. Place a bucket beneath the work area to catch residual water and protect flooring. Turn off water valves beneath the sink first to avoid water spillage.
In classic compression faucets, gently remove the cap, unscrew the handle, pull it off, then unscrew the stem. At the base of the stem, extract the old washer, clean the valve seat thoroughly to remove scale, install a new washer, and reassemble everything securely. Test operation after restoring water flow to ensure no leaks remain.
Cartridge faucets follow a different procedure: remove any retaining clip or nut, pull the old cartridge straight upward, lubricate new O-rings, insert the replacement cartridge, and secure all components. Ceramic disc models generally require complete cartridge replacement rather than individual part swaps due to their sealed design. Once reassembled, gradually restore water and inspect connections for leaks. Tighten gently if minor seepage appears. These methods work effectively for straightforward repairs. Regular maintenance serves as the best way to prevent future dripping faucets. Every few months, remove aerators and soak in vinegar to remove scale that blocks flow and causes drips. Regularly examine handles and stems for looseness, odd motion, or corrosion signaling problems. Use food-safe grease on O-rings during inspections to keep them flexible and sealing well.
Think about installing low-flow aerators or touchless faucets as smart improvements. These upgrades cut water use and include hard-water-resistant components.
